Order | Filed: May 15, 2024 | Entered: May 15, 2024 Bentz v. Marion, Kansas, City of et al
Civil Rights: Other | Kansas
Show Cause ~Util - Set Motion and R&R Deadlines/Hearings
NOTICE AND ORDER TO SHOW CAUSE ENTERED: The Court orders Plaintiff to show cause in writing to the undersigned Magistrate Judge, on or before May 29, 2024, why this case should not be consolidated with 23-1179 Debbie K. Gruver v. Gideon Cody; 24- 2044 Phyllis J. Zorn v. City of Marion, Kansas, et al.; and 24-2122 Eric Meyer, individually, and as the executor of the Estate of Joan Meyer, et al. v. City of Marion, Kansas, et al. for all pretrial proceedings pursuant to Fed. R. Civ. P. 42(a)(2) to promote judicial economy. Defendants' deadline for response is June 5, 2024. The case will be set for a hearing on June 13, 2024 at 10:00 a.m. in Wichita courtroom 326. Additionally, in light of the defenses raised in Defendants' motions to dismiss in this and other actions, at the hearing the parties shall be prepared to discuss any issues related to the stay of discovery. Signed by Magistrate Judge Gwynne E. Birzer on 5/15/2024. (jal)
